🏆Match Winner
The most straightforward bet in snooker is predicting the match winner. It’s about identifying which player will triumph in the contest. For instance, if Barry Hawkins is playing against Jimmy Robertson, you should determine who will clinch a victory. With diligent research, you can make accurate bets. The payout here varies between 92-94%.
🏆Frame Betting
Frame betting is one of the most popular options for punters. Whether they predict the frame winner, delve into frame handicap betting, or wager on the total points in a frame, this market can offer prolific returns.
For example, in the match between Yuan Sijun and Jordan Brown, it is possible to bet on more than 4.5 total frames. The payout here will be 91-93%.
🏆Handicap Betting
Handicap betting levels the playing field. If one player is perceived as stronger, he might be disadvantaged in frames, making the odds more attractive. This offers intriguing strategic potential for bettors looking to back the underdog or solidify their faith in the favourite.
For illustration, if Liam Pullen is playing against Zak Surety, you might consider a handicap. The payout here usually ranges between 91-93%.
🏆Highest Break
A bet on the highest break is a wager on which player will achieve the highest single-frame score in a match. Recognizing a player’s scoring prowess and ability to string together long breaks can be vital in mastering this market. You can consider this option in the match between Jackson Page and Himanshu Jain. The payout here varies but is between 92-94%.
🏆Total Centuries Bet
This bet centres on the cumulative century breaks in a match. You should predict whether the two players will manage more or fewer centuries than the bet number, for example, 1.5 or 2.5. Whether you’re wagering on a low or high-scoring contest, understanding the players’ track records and current form can provide insights into how many century breaks might be seen. The payout here ranges between 93-95%.
🏆Century Break Betting
The Century Break Betting market is a solid option for punters. From bets on total century breaks, which player will make a century, to predicting if a century break will occur in a specific frame, it is a profitable selection.
If Jak Jones and Rory McLeod are playing, you can place a bet on the first player to make a century break. The payout is between 90 and 93%.
🏆Player Specials
Player Specials revolve around specific player achievements, and they’ve become a prominent market among UK punters. Whether it’s wagering on a player making a precise break, potting the black off the break, or achieving a century in a particular frame, this market teems with personalized betting options.
For example, you might think Judd Trump will make a precise break against Mark Selby. The payout here will be 92-94%.

🔦Break Building Analysis
Understanding a player’s ability to construct significant breaks, especially under tight situations, is paramount. Some players thrive under pressure, making them reliable bets during clutch moments. If you have a look at the past records and results, Judd Trump stands out from other players, making him the best option for break building.
🔦Predicting Frame Length
By observing how players approach their games – aggressively or defensively – you can make educated guesses on the length of individual frames. This knowledge can be a goldmine, especially in over/under frame length bets.
🔦Session Betting
For more extended duels, like those in the World Snooker Championship, betting on individual sessions can prove lucrative. It allows you to capitalize on shifts in momentum and player fatigue. For example, in a particular session, one player might find the rhythm and beat the other one. That’s the point you should exploit and make the momentum work for you.
🔦Accumulator Betting
While they carry higher risks, accumulator bets can provide substantial returns. By bundling your predictions, especially in matches where you’re confident about outcomes, you stand to increase your potential winnings. For instance, if you include 3 or more selections with odds of 1.40, they will be multiplied, and in case you have predicted the results right, the payout will be more significant.
🔦Recent Head-to-Head Records
While long-term head-to-head stats are informative, focusing on recent encounters can offer more insights into player form and psychological dynamics. Evaluating performances from the last few encounters can give a clearer picture, helping you to make more informed decisions.
